Was this page helpful?
Your feedback about this content is important. Let us know what you think.
Additional feedback?
1500 characters remaining
Project.ProjectType Enumeration
Collapse the table of content
Expand the table of content

Project.ProjectType Enumeration

Specifies the type of project.

Namespace:  Microsoft.Office.Project.Server.Library
Assembly:  Microsoft.Office.Project.Server.Library (in Microsoft.Office.Project.Server.Library.dll)

public enum ProjectType

Member nameDescription
MinRequestValueValue=0. Internal only; do not use.
VoidValue=-1. Internal only; do not use.
ProjectValue=0. A standard project.
TemplateValue=1. A project template.
GlobalValue=2. Enterprise global template.
ResGlobalValue=3. Enterprise resource pool.
LightWeightProjectValue=4. A project proposal.
InsertedProjectValue=5. A subproject.
MasterProjectValue=6. Master project.
TimesheetAdminProjectValue=7. Timesheet administrative project, used in upgrades from Microsoft Office Project Server 2007. For more information, see the Reporting database schema reference.
NewProjectValue=100. Internal only; do not use.
NewTemplateValue=101. Internal only; do not use.
NewGlobalValue=102. Internal only; do not use.
NewResGlobalValue=103. Internal only; do not use.
InactiveProjectValue=1000. Internal only; do not use.
InactiveTemplateValue=1001. Internal only; do not use.
InactiveGlobalValue=1002. Internal only; do not use.
NewOffsetValue=100. Internal only; do not use.
InactiveOffsetValue=1000. Internal only; do not use.
MaxRequestValueValue=101. Internal only; do not use.

The only valid project types the PSI can create are Project, Template, LightWeightProject, MasterProject, and InsertedProject. The other project types are for internal use and are not described.

The Global and ResGlobal values correspond to the enterprise global template and the enterprise resource pool in versions of Microsoft Office Project Server prior to 2007. In Project Server, the enterprise global and enterprise resource pool are not projects.

For more information, see the ReadProjectStatus PSI method.

Community Additions

ADD
Show:
© 2015 Microsoft